Boomp vs. Zoho Social: Done-For-You Posting vs. Budget Scheduling (2026)

Zoho Social is the most affordable social media scheduling tool on the market, starting at just $10/month. Boomp costs $99/month but creates your content for you. The price difference tells only part of the story.

Quick Comparison

FactorBoompZoho Social
What it doesCreates AND publishes content for youSchedule and manage content you create
Monthly cost$99 (single plan)$10-40 (Standard-Premium, annual billing)
Your time5 minutes setup5-10 hours/month
Creates content?✅ Yes — 12 original posts/month❌ No — AI caption assist only
Creates images?✅ Yes — custom images❌ No — integrates with Pixabay, Pexels
CRM integration❌ No✅ Yes — deep Zoho CRM integration
Social listening❌ No✅ Yes (monitoring columns)
Social inbox❌ No✅ Yes — unified messaging
AnalyticsBasicDetailed with custom reports
Team collaboration❌ Not applicable✅ Approval workflows, roles
PlatformsFaceb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, TikTokFaceb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, X, TikTok, Google Business, Pinterest, YouTube
Free plan❌ No✅ Yes — 1 brand, limited features
Best forBusiness owners who want zero effortBudget-conscious teams already doing social media

When Zoho Social Is the Better Choice

Zoho Social is genuinely excellent if you:

  • Already use Zoho CRM — the integration is seamless and powerful
  • Have a team member who does social media — give them the cheapest professional tool
  • Need a free plan to start with — Zoho's free tier is legitimate
  • Want social listening — monitor brand mentions and conversations
  • Manage multiple platforms including X, Pinterest, YouTube, Google Business
  • Want the lowest possible subscription cost and have time for content creation
  • Need CRM-connected social media — see social interactions alongside customer data

Bottom line: If you're a Zoho ecosystem user with a team member who creates content, Zoho Social is probably the best value in the market.
